Willow Tree Barn is one of those places where you feel at home as soon as you walk through the door. This barn conversion is fitted out to a high standard with natural oak finishes and large windows and has generous amounts of space throughout. The ground floor is all open plan so you can move easily between the lounge (with a superb large logburner), and the kitchen/ dining area. This property has proven to be very popular with guests and their pet dogs (up to 2 permitted). It's ideal if you are seeking a peaceful edge of village location that is quick to reach from the M6, located in the South Lakes area of the Lake District, and has lots of great walks and pubs serving great food on the doorstep.
You will be staying in the left-hand half of the property, with your own private entrance. Enter through the double-height glazed doors into the open-plan area. Head over to the kitchen area fitted with modern built-in appliances, including a full-size fridge freezer, a good amount of storage and very good worktop space. The stylish dining table seats four with ease, and it's just a few steps then to take your place on the excellent 3 seater sofa or armchair. Here, you can enjoy catching up on your favourite programmes on the Smart TV and be warmed through by the double-height log burner. Underfloor heating throughout this property ensures a steady comfortable temperature.
Upstairs to the two well-proportioned double bedrooms. The first bedroom has a Double pine bedstead and storage furniture, Velux window, and an en-suite with walk-in shower. The second bedroom has a Kingsize divan bed and has mirrored built-in wardrobes, bedside tables, and a Velux window and the en suite is very smartly fitted with full tiling and has a bath with shower over. There is a third small room which can be used for storage or as a clothes drying room. Outside, there is a picnic table, a bench, and ample parking space.We also have Willow Tree Glamping Pod, a sleeps 2 pod at the same location which can be booked separately.
The Wheatsheaf in Brigsteer is your local pub (8 minute walk) and has a good reputation for food (booking recommended). A short drive away, you will find several other very well-regarded pubs, including The Punch Bowl, and The Black Labrador, both at Crosthwaite, The Masons Arms at Strawberry Bank, and the Hare and Hounds at Bowland Bridge. You are within easy driving distance of Lake Windermere, the high Lake District fells and, in the attractive market town of Kendal (6 miles), you will be spoilt for choice with pubs, restaurants, cafes and entertainment, including the famous Brewery Arts Centre which has cinemas, live events, and exhibitions.
